Bamboo Toothbrushes Are Environmentally Friendly:

Based on current trends, there is a high likelihood that some plastic waste will end up in the ocean, endangering marine life. When you throw away a used plastic toothbrush, it may be swallowed by an albatross, a whale, a dugong, a penguin, or a sea lion. Using a bamboo toothbrush is an eco-friendly option that you should think about for the sake of the environment. Bamboo toothbrush handles can be composted because they degrade naturally. Bamboo Brushes Are Sustainable To Manufacture:

Bamboo, as a plant, can be cultivated repeatedly without harming the environment. The stems grow quickly and do not require fertilisers or pesticides to thrive. Plastic toothbrushes are made from non-sustainable materials, and their production involves the use of hazardous chemicals and processes. Safe for Brushing Teeth:

If you see, bamboo plants are grown naturally, usually, they are grown without any toxins or chemicals. The shoots of the same bamboo plant are often used in varied Asian and African cuisine. Thereby, they are perfectly safe for humans. The non-edible hard part of the bamboo can be processed and used to make toothbrushes. It is completely safe for toothbrush manufacturing and your teeth. However, more often than not the bristles of the bamboo toothbrush are made up of nylon fibre. But some brands do make toothbrushes made out of boar hair.
